How to install the WhatsApp program on a laptop - in detail?

Installing WhatsApp on your laptop is a straightforward process, allowing you to stay connected with friends and family without needing to switch between devices. Here’s a detailed guide on how to get started:

Prerequisites

Before you begin, ensure that your laptop meets the following requirements:

  • Operating System: Windows 8.1 or higher, macOS 10.9 or higher.
  • Internet Connection: A stable internet connection is essential for downloading and activating WhatsApp on your laptop.
  • Camera and Microphone: These are necessary for video calls and voice messages.

Step-by-Step Guide

For Windows:

  2. Install WhatsApp:

    • Once the download is complete, open the installer file and follow the prompts to install WhatsApp on your laptop.
    • The installation process is automated and typically takes a few minutes.
  3. Set Up WhatsApp:

    • After installation, launch WhatsApp. You’ll see a QR code on your screen.
    • On your mobile device, open the WhatsApp app and go to Settings > Linked Devices.
    • Tap "Link a Device" and scan the QR code displayed on your laptop screen using your phone's camera.
  4. Verification:

    • Once the QR code is scanned successfully, you’ll receive a confirmation on both your laptop and mobile device.
    • Your WhatsApp account will now be linked to your laptop, allowing you to send messages, make calls, and share media directly from your computer.

For macOS:

  2. Install WhatsApp:

    • Open the downloaded .dmg file and drag the WhatsApp icon into your Applications folder.
    • Launch WhatsApp from your Applications folder.
  3. Set Up WhatsApp:

    • Follow the same steps as for Windows to link your mobile device to your laptop:
      • Open WhatsApp on your mobile device, go to Settings > Linked Devices.
      • Tap "Link a Device" and scan the QR code displayed on your laptop screen using your phone's camera.
  4. Verification:

    • Once the QR code is scanned successfully, you’ll receive a confirmation on both your laptop and mobile device.
    • Your WhatsApp account will now be linked to your Mac, enabling you to use all of WhatsApp's features directly from your computer.

Tips for Optimal Use

  • Keep Both Devices Connected: Ensure that your mobile device remains connected to the internet while using WhatsApp on your laptop. This ensures seamless syncing of messages and other data.
  • Update Regularly: Keep both your WhatsApp app and your laptop's operating system updated to benefit from the latest features and security enhancements.
